On Thursday 28 March 2002 20:14, Koos Vriezen wrote:
> On Thu, 28 Mar 2002, David Faure wrote:
>
> > The patch looks good on the whole (thanks for the testing you did on it!)
> >
> > The SIGPIPE stuff looks good too. The first patch which wanted to remove the exit
> > in SlaveBase::sigpipe_handler was wrong because that handler is also called when
> > the application exits (the sigpipe comes from the app pipe in that case). So this
> > approach is better since it allows to distinguish between the two cases for \
> > sigpipes... well, assuming the app doesn't crash/exit at the exact moment of this \
> > write() :}
> > The one thing that surprises me is:
> > - if ( cmd=="list" && maxretries > 0 ) // Only retry for "list". retr/stor/... \
> > need to redo the whole thing + if ( maxretries > 0 ) // Only retry for "list". \
> > retr/stor/... need to redo the whole thing { Hmm, I'm sure I added that comment \
> > for a reason... Yes, one needs to do the PASV stuff first, etc.
> > Without the test, isn't this going to try and do the RETR or STOR
> > before the initial setup stuff like PASV, EPSV, etc. ?
> > (or if I'm wrong, then the comment must be removed ;)
>
> I removed it because a timeout with "cwd" wouldn't reconnect. Didn't look
> that carefully at retr/stor, but probably always calling
> ftpSendCmd("xxx", 0) in ftpOpenCommand should be enough.
Sounds good.
No idea how to support timeouts with stor/retr though (can't be an idle
timeout anyway, more like the ftp server being shutdown I guess).
